Wed 04 Sep 2013 02:03:23 PM UTC, comment #6: 

Hi John,

indeed, the spam filter was configured in a way that discarded any message that doesn't match the old CVS commit messages.  I've adapted that to the new Git commit messages, and now they make it to the list.

One remaining problem, though:  The subject of these mails is like

  [SCM] UNNAMED PROJECT branch, master, updated. 346206b80dd119abff25dccee39442e45ae3b8f5

and inside the mail UNNAMED PROJECT also occurs twice.

I guess the reason for that is the same why

  http://git.savannah.gnu.org/cgit/auctex.git

shows "Unnamed repository; edit this file 'description' to name the repository.".

So could you please edit auctex.git/description to contain just "GNU AUCTeX" instead of the sentence above?

Wed 12 Jun 2013 07:21:57 AM UTC, comment #2: 

Hi Michael,

then please send the full diffs+commits mails to auctex-diffs@gnu.org.

What do you use for the notifications?  Git comes with a script

  /usr/share/git/contrib/hooks/post-receive-email

that can be used for that purpose.  Depending on how you configure hooks.showrev, you can include/exclude diffs.  The default is just to display the commit id, author, date and log message, as it would be appropriate for the -email is unavailable- mailing list.
